RDJ Posted February 22, 2024 Share #43 Posted February 22, 2024 I just bought a Sept 2023 re-paint which Cameraworks-UK refurbished. The paint is described as a semi-gloss black Cerakote (H-109). I understand Cerakote more durable than many paints. The semi gloss surface looks great…not too shiny and the paint is smooth with a tiny sign of orange peel….and I probably overstate the word orange peel. Its likely impossible to have a dead smooth surface. The finish and camera operation are beautiful. Painted black M3 window bumps fade in the background.
